And they鈥檙e off! Ride like an Italian pro

The starting gun fired on Saturday at the National Exhibition and Convention Center in Qingpu for Ride Like a Pro, a bicycle race managed by Giro d鈥橧talia ­鈥 Italy鈥檚 equivalent of the Tour de France.

The first day of the race was five 5-kilometer circuits around the NECC trapezoid track of continuous curves.

It included three hairpin turns in the middle, quite challenging for the riders.

At 8am, the professionals set off. Timothy Wilcox, Robert Regis and Daniel Boettger dominated from the start.

They opened a wide lead after only 10 minutes.

Wilcox and Regis crossed the finish line together in 40 minutes and 15 seconds.

They held each other鈥檚 shoulders as they crossed the line.

Apart from the professionals, Ride Like a Pro had plenty of fun activities for families and friends.

Around noon, children and parents took part in a fun ride on the 2.5-kilometer track, cheered on by the crowd on the side of the road much as the pros had been.

Alberto Contador and Andy Schleck, two legendary riders and rivals and former Tour de France winners, also had an interesting battle on children鈥檚 bikes, capping a happy end to the day.
